New Albany Country Club is a prestigious private club located in the picturesque community of New Albany, Ohio. Nestled just five minutes away from the major interstates 270 and 161 and a short ten-minute drive from Easton, this club offers an exclusive and serene environment for its members. Known for its elegant and formal dining experiences surrounded by beautiful facilities, the club is committed to delivering exceptional service and creating a memorable atmosphere for every visitor. Job Duties

  • Work closely with multiple teams and teammates to fulfill and exceed member expectations
  • Provide excellent food and beverage service to members & guests ensuring consistent satisfaction
  • Follow procedures, protocols, and steps of service to ensure the entire team is set up to succeed in providing great experiences to our members
  • Ensure the proper set up of individual rooms and areas on a daily basis
  • Maintain consistent high service standards, as outlined in training
  • Display complete and comprehensive knowledge of the menu, including beverage offerings and daily features that may not be printed on the menu
  • Follow daily opening/closing procedures, complete daily checklists, and execute day-to-day operations independently
  • Guarantee all areas are member-ready at all times
  • Accurately execute member and guest orders and requests in a timely fashion
  • Become familiar with members' names and greet them accordingly in a manner to provide a warm welcome that will make them feel right at home
  • Assist fellow team members to provide unique, personalized service that cannot be found anywhere else!
  • Responsible for possessing thorough knowledge of all various liquors, beer and wines offered by the Club
